comfy

It is comfy, but when compared to the fantastic original, it is incredibly clumsy. The story setup is pretty weak and starts pretty much right away with little build-up. It's full of awkward edits and action scene setups and the cinematography of Oliver Wood isn't very classy when compared to Jan De Bont. Also the characters feel a lot meaner and nasty than in the original - yes, even McClane with his "fat fucks" and overall shitty attitude.

You can tell that this was a quick cash grab production and Renny Harlin, already not a very good director, was essentially making two movies at the same time (Ford Fairlane being the other one). Not to mention the fact that you can clearly see that Willis was in his "fuck yeah, I'm a superstar" attitude during this with his "cool as fuck" mannerisms and the use of a lot of stuntmen even in the simplest of fights. McClane already feels like a caricature of himself.

But like I said, still comfy.

Music is good though, but that's Michael Kamen and mostly recycled themes and of course Finlandia by Sibelius.
